Black and White Publishingīlack and White Publishing, a leading Scottish independent publisher, no longer accepts unsolicited fiction manuscripts (since October 2019.) Follow their submissions page to learn when or if they may reopen submissions again. With a portfolio of more than 100 monthly ebook and print titles, Harlequin publishes numerous bestselling authors with titles regularly featured in USA TODAY, Publishers Weekly, and Bookscan bestseller lists. Now part of the HarperCollins publishing group, Harlequin has been one of the leading romance book publishers for women for the previous 70 years. Make sure you follow the submission guidelines and you may have the opportunity to join many New York Times bestselling authors, including Tracy Wolff, whose series Crave instantly topped New York Times bestselling lists.
